Winning Your Insurance Claim: Strategies for Dispute Resolution

Navigating the process of insurance claims can often be a challenging endeavor, particularly when disputes occur. If your claim is refused, don't despair. There are strategic steps you can utilize to effectively settle the dispute and increase your probability of a successful outcome.

First, it's vital to thoroughly scrutinize your policy terms to comprehend your coverage and the specific reasons for denial. Subsequently, meticulously compile all relevant facts to support your claim, including images, receipts, testimonies, and any other applicable details.

When communicating with the insurance provider, maintain a respectful tone and clearly outline your concerns and expectations. If direct discussion proves fruitless, consider obtaining assistance from an experienced insurance representative who can guide you through the appeal procedure.

Remember, knowledge is power in the realm of insurance claims. By arming yourself with awareness and strategic strategies, you can enhance your chances of a favorable resolution.

Confronting Insurance Disputes: Effective Tactics

Insurance disputes can be a frustrating ordeal. When you find yourself locked in a disagreement over coverage or claims, it's essential to act decisively. Don't succumb to pressure. By prepping for these common tactics, you can bolster your position of a favorable result.

First and foremost, thoroughly examine your policy documents. Understand the terms regarding coverage limits, exclusions, and procedures for filing claims.

Then, gather all relevant documentation, such as police reports, medical records, and repair estimates. Submit your evidence in a clear, concise, and systematic manner.

If direct negotiations with the insurance company prove unsatisfactory, consider seeking the support of an experienced legal professional. They can represent you through the complex regulations and mediate on your behalf. Remember, you have rights under the law. Don't be afraid to assert them.
